Benvenuto Ospite,
per utilizzare il Forum ed avere accesso a tutte le sezioni e poter aprire un tuo Topic, rispondere nelle varie discussioni, mandare o ricevere Messaggi Privati devi seguire pochi passaggi:


Leggi il nostro Regolamento -> PREMI QUI <-
Segui il link su come Iscriversi -> PREMI QUI <-


Ricordati di aggiornare l'Avatar usando una immagine che ti distingua nel Forum

Problema Wahcade

Frontend per cabinati... chi, cosa, come!!!
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Problema Wahcade

Messaggio da boosst »

Buongiorno a tutti.
Ogni volta che apro wahcade il fronten va in crash restituendo questi errori..

Traceback (most recent call last):
File "wahcade.py", line 86, in <module>
app = WinMain(options)
File "/usr/local/share/wahcade/win_main.py", line 334, in __init__
self.load_emulator()
File "/usr/local/share/wahcade/win_main.py", line 1290, in load_emulator
self.load_list()
File "/usr/local/share/wahcade/win_main.py", line 1334, in load_list
self.pop_games_list()
File "/usr/local/share/wahcade/win_main.py", line 1598, in pop_games_list
self.emu_ini)
File "/usr/local/share/wahcade/filters.py", line 386, in create_initial_filter
gd = mi.next()
File "/usr/local/share/wahcade/filters.py", line 215, in get_xml_game_item
for event, mame_element in ET.iterparse(xml_filename, events=('start', 'end')):
File "<string>", line 91, in next
ParseError: syntax error: line 1, column 0

Cosa potrebbe essere? :on_cry:
Premetto che il frontend funzionava perfettamente e questo errore si è presentato da quando ho cancellato per sbaglio un gioco dalla lista..
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

Hai provato a fargli ricreare la lista dei giochi?
---
Earth could be the hell of another world.
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

Ci avevo pensato anche io ma non posso perchè wahcade va in crash subito ed esce..
Pensavo di rimuoverlo completamente e reinstallarlo ma non ho idea di come si possa fare.. <-help2->
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

Prova a spostare i file di configurazione, così si dovrebbe avviare come se fosse la prima volta che lo esegui; poi ricrei la lista e torni a mettere i vecchi file di configurazione (ovviamente senza sovrascrivere la nuova lista dei giochi).
---
Earth could be the hell of another world.
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

Quali file intendi? quelli nella cartella .wahcade?
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

Sì, i file di configurazione dovrebbero essere in "~/.wahcade" (se mi ricordo bene).
Quindi dovrebbe bastare rinominare la directory:

Codice: Seleziona tutto

$ mv ~/.wahcade ~/.wahcade_OLD
---
Earth could be the hell of another world.
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

ok dopo provo..
Possono essere anche i file in "/usr/local/share/wahcade" che "rompono"?
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

Non credo: quelli dovrebbero essere file "di sistema", non configurazioni personali :roll: .
---
Earth could be the hell of another world.
Avatar utente
eldiau

Donatore
Cab-maniaco
Cab-maniaco
Messaggi: 1021
Iscritto il: 20/01/2012, 9:57
Medaglie: 1
Città: Torino
Grazie Ricevuti: 2 volte

Re: Problema Wahcade

Messaggio da eldiau »

boosst ha scritto:Buongiorno a tutti.
Ogni volta che apro wahcade il fronten va in crash restituendo questi errori..

Traceback (most recent call last):
File "wahcade.py", line 86, in <module>
app = WinMain(options)
File "/usr/local/share/wahcade/win_main.py", line 334, in __init__
self.load_emulator()
File "/usr/local/share/wahcade/win_main.py", line 1290, in load_emulator
self.load_list()
File "/usr/local/share/wahcade/win_main.py", line 1334, in load_list
self.pop_games_list()
File "/usr/local/share/wahcade/win_main.py", line 1598, in pop_games_list
self.emu_ini)
File "/usr/local/share/wahcade/filters.py", line 386, in create_initial_filter
gd = mi.next()
File "/usr/local/share/wahcade/filters.py", line 215, in get_xml_game_item
for event, mame_element in ET.iterparse(xml_filename, events=('start', 'end')):
File "<string>", line 91, in next
ParseError: syntax error: line 1, column 0

Cosa potrebbe essere? :on_cry:
Premetto che il frontend funzionava perfettamente e questo errore si è presentato da quando ho cancellato per sbaglio un gioco dalla lista..
potrebbe anche essere un errore nel parsing del xml di mame, se metti una opzione che mame non riconosce in mame.ini questo butta un errore insieme all'xml quando lo lanci con "-listsml" e wahcade si "confonde" se deve ricreare la lista.

Prova a dare "mame -listsml | less" e vedi se l'output inizia con "<?xml version="1.0"?>" o se ce'e' un errore in cima e nel caso correggi mame.ini
Progetti:
*BarettoCab80 viewtopic.php?t=8756
*Mariocab
*TrashSticks

Guide:
*Guida a Linux nel Cab: http://www.arcadeitalia.net/viewtopic.php?t=9608
*Effetti GLSL in SDLMAME: http://www.arcadeitalia.net/viewtopic.php?t=9494
*Versioni di MAME "importanti": http://www.arcadeitalia.net/viewtopic.php?t=12209
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

eldiau ha scritto:potrebbe anche essere un errore nel parsing del xml di mame, se metti una opzione che mame non riconosce in mame.ini questo butta un errore insieme all'xml quando lo lanci con "-listsml" e wahcade si "confonde" se deve ricreare la lista.

Prova a dare "mame -listsml | less" e vedi se l'output inizia con "<?xml version="1.0"?>" o se ce'e' un errore in cima e nel caso correggi mame.ini
Maybe you meant "-listxml"?
---
Earth could be the hell of another world.
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

<-shake2-> Vi ringrazio entrambi ma ho risolto in un modo più brutale..
Ho reistallato tutto in un'oretta e adesso funge alla perfezione.
<-rofl->
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

Ma hai reinstallato perché i nostri consigli non hanno funzionato, o perché avevi un'ora libera e non sapevi cosa fare?
---
Earth could be the hell of another world.
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

Spostare i file di configurazione non ha portato nessun risultato.. Stesso medesimo errore.
La soluzione suggerita da eldiau purtroppo non l'ho provata in quanto ho letto il post troppo tardi..
Però sarei curioso di sapere se magari era quello.. <-think->
Avatar utente
eldiau

Donatore
Cab-maniaco
Cab-maniaco
Messaggi: 1021
Iscritto il: 20/01/2012, 9:57
Medaglie: 1
Città: Torino
Grazie Ricevuti: 2 volte

Re: Problema Wahcade

Messaggio da eldiau »

Ansa89 ha scritto:
eldiau ha scritto:p "-listsml" e wahcade si "confonde" se deve ricreare la lista.

Prova a dare "mame -listsml | less" e vedi se l'output inizia con "<?xml version="1.0"?>" o se ce'e' un errore in cima e nel caso correggi mame.ini
Maybe you meant "-listxml"?
No no, SML e' un XML di origine bolognese ;) e lo ho pure scritto due volte!
Progetti:
*BarettoCab80 viewtopic.php?t=8756
*Mariocab
*TrashSticks

Guide:
*Guida a Linux nel Cab: http://www.arcadeitalia.net/viewtopic.php?t=9608
*Effetti GLSL in SDLMAME: http://www.arcadeitalia.net/viewtopic.php?t=9494
*Versioni di MAME "importanti": http://www.arcadeitalia.net/viewtopic.php?t=12209
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

eldiau ha scritto:No no, SML e' un XML di origine bolognese ;)
<-on_lol-> <-on_lol->
---
Earth could be the hell of another world.
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

Reistallando il tutto su un altro pc è rispuntata fuori tutta la serie di errori.
Questa volta (al posto di formattare <-on_redface-> ) wahcade-setup ho fatto "File > Reser filters".
In questo modo wahcade si avvia ma non mostra nessun gioco.. neanche se gli rigenero la lista.
Mi sono accorto che se ne programma di setup vado nel tab "extra" e gli faccio generare l'xml al successivo avvio rispunta fuori l'errore.
Ho risolto mettendo in list generation method "rom directory".
Facendo così wahcade si avvia e mostra la lista dei giochi correttamente.
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

Grazie per aver condiviso la soluzione, sarà sicuramente di aiuto per tutte le altre persone che incontrano questo tipo di problema <-on_smile-> .
---
Earth could be the hell of another world.
Avatar utente
eldiau

Donatore
Cab-maniaco
Cab-maniaco
Messaggi: 1021
Iscritto il: 20/01/2012, 9:57
Medaglie: 1
Città: Torino
Grazie Ricevuti: 2 volte

Re: Problema Wahcade

Messaggio da eldiau »

Ciao, il modo in cui hai risolto sarebbe consistente con il problema che ipotizzavo piu' su:

"Prova a dare "mame -listxml | less" e vedi se l'output inizia con "<?xml version="1.0"?>" o se ce'e' un errore in cima e nel caso correggi mame.ini"

Giusto per curiosita', potresti eseguire "mame -listxml" e vedere se l'output e' un xml valido?
Progetti:
*BarettoCab80 viewtopic.php?t=8756
*Mariocab
*TrashSticks

Guide:
*Guida a Linux nel Cab: http://www.arcadeitalia.net/viewtopic.php?t=9608
*Effetti GLSL in SDLMAME: http://www.arcadeitalia.net/viewtopic.php?t=9494
*Versioni di MAME "importanti": http://www.arcadeitalia.net/viewtopic.php?t=12209
Avatar utente
boosst

Donatore
Affezionato
Affezionato
Messaggi: 234
Iscritto il: 28/02/2012, 14:07
Medaglie: 1
Città: Caselon
Località: Verona
Grazie Inviati: 2 volte

Re: Problema Wahcade

Messaggio da boosst »

Salve a tutti.
Ho scoperto il motivo dell'errore che mandava in crash il frontend.
Il problema (ed è solo colpa mia <-on_redface-> )è che non avevo messo il carattere # davanti alla variabile numprocessor nel mame.ini.
Eliminando quel parametro tutto fila liscio.
Spero non mi vogliate picchiare per questa grossolana distrazione..
:love:
Avatar utente
Ansa89
Cab-maniaco
Cab-maniaco
Messaggi: 1511
Iscritto il: 19/06/2011, 8:43
Città: EarthRealm

Re: Problema Wahcade

Messaggio da Ansa89 »

boosst ha scritto:Spero non mi vogliate picchiare per questa grossolana distrazione..
Al contratio: sono felice che tu abbia risolto :-D .
Inoltre hai fatto bene a postare la tua soluzione, così se altri avranno lo stesso problema sapranno cosa modificare.
---
Earth could be the hell of another world.
Rispondi

Torna a “Frontend”